If you're using Windows and just want getWizPnP.exe not the YARDWiz GUI program, the setup.exe in the YARDWiz download doesn't need to be run/installed, it can just be opened with a zip file program (7zip works, I've not tried WinZip) and getWizPnP.exe extracted. If using OSX , the DMG can just be m...

You could try installing PAR::Packer from cpan. Needs a bit of fiddling though. Win32::Exe won't build with the version of the MingW C compiler (gcc 3.*) that cpan installs. Nor will it compile with the latest MingW (gcc 4.8.1). I compiled it successfully by installing an older version of the MingW ...

One way if you are adventurous. I believe the S1 is flaky with anything other than WEP. Find a cheap wireless N router that can be be flashed with DD-WRT. Flash it and then set it up as a wireless bridge (client bridge). Read the DD-WRT wiki. You then have several sockets to Ethernet wire to. I hav...
